Hi Michelangelo !

Skyrim and Borderlands were supported by Vireio <=v3. The new Vireio v4 alpha currently only supports DX11 games, i'm on the ball to add DX9 support to create game profiles for all games we already supported.

Dead Island Riptide Definitive Edition is maybe DX11, i don't know. Once we are able to finish the new DX9 core our game support will dramatically increase, Dead Island RDE is definately on our list.

The manual is also for Vireio v3, Vireio v4 is still in alpha stage.
